Types of Battery Chargers and Their Uses
Different battery chargers are designed with specific needs in mind, and choosing the right one starts with knowing how each one works.
Trickle Chargers
These deliver a steady, low current to keep batteries topped off over extended periods of time. Trickle chargers are ideal for seasonal equipment like boats, motorcycles, and generators. This charger allows them to sit for potentially months and prevents the battery from losing charge when it's needed.
Fast Chargers
Fast chargers provide a higher current for rapid recharge, making them optimal when you have limited time to charge: quickly topping off an EcoFlow RIVER 3 Plus, for example, before heading out for a weekend camping trip. A quality fast charger will have safety features to prevent overheating and overcharging.
Solar Chargers
Solar chargers convert sunlight into usable power. They offer a renewable energy source ideal for off-grid use. Solar chargers are also scalable and work well with devices like the EcoFlow DELTA 3 when camping or RVing. They also work great for emergencies, like when grid power fails.
Smart Chargers
These are great for finicky or older batteries. Smart chargers adjust voltage and current (amps) based on the battery’s condition. They prevent overcharging, extend battery life, and can be used with an array of battery chemistries, including lithium-ion and lead-acid batteries.

How to Match a Charger to Your Device or Application
Picking the right charger begins with knowing your device’s voltage and current requirements. Using a charger with the wrong specs can lead to slow performance, damage to the battery, and even safety hazards. Check the device manufacturer’s recommended input range and match your charger accordingly.
For small electronics such as smartphones and tablets, focus on chargers that provide the proper USB-C and USB-A outputs with sufficient wattage. For portable power stations such as the EcoFlow RIVER 3 Plus or EcoFlow DELTA 3, a higher wattage charger will significantly reduce downtime, especially before an extended road trip.
You’ll want to consider your surroundings as well. If you’ll be off the beaten path, a solar charger or a hybrid charging station is probably a better choice. If you know your equipment is going to be stored for long periods of time, then a trickle charger will maintain battery health and equipment longevity.
Remember, charger compatibility is about having the right connectors and ensuring you have the right charging profile. Lithium-ion batteries, for example, need precise voltage regulation. So, matching your charger to both battery chemistry and your specific needs will ensure faster charging, safer operation, and longer service life for your devices.
Features To Look for in an Ideal Battery Charger
The best battery chargers combine efficient operation, safety, and convenience.
Here are the key factors to consider:
Smart Charging: A charger that identifies a battery’s condition and automatically adjusts current and voltage will maximize charging speed while preventing damage to the device.
Safety Protocols: Look out for overcurrent, overvoltage, and temperature safeguards. These will protect the charger and the battery, and are especially beneficial for lithium-ion batteries that require stricter charging regulations.

Multiple Outputs: Having a variety of charging port types (USB-C, DC, etc.) allows you to charge different devices without having to pack multiple chargers.
Energy Source Compatibility: If you’ll be using solar power or DC vehicle charging, ensure your charger is compatible with these input types. This is vital for powering portable stations while being off-grid.
Durability: Being outdoors requires more rugged gear. To get the most life out of your charger, be sure to get one with weather-resistant materials and reinforced connectors.
By considering these features, you’ll get a charger that works for your current devices and will adapt to your future needs, too.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Use One Battery Charger for All My Devices?
It depends, and may not always be possible. While some chargers are more versatile, each device has specific voltage and current requisites. Utilizing an incompatible charger can cause slower charges, overheating, and damage to the battery. Try to find a charger that meets the specifications for all of the devices you plan to connect, or opt for a multi-output model designed for mixed use.
What’s the Safest Charger for Lithium-Ion Batteries?
The safest chargers for lithium-ion batteries are smart chargers with built-in voltage monitoring, overcurrent protection, and temperature regulation. These features prevent overcharging, overheating, and short circuits, all of which can shorten battery life or cause safety issues. Always use chargers designed for lithium-ion chemistry and certified by recognized safety standards.
